Enhancing Your Google My Business Profile

The Key to Local Business Success

Establishing a robust online presence is crucial for any business aiming to thrive in a competitive market. Optimizing your Google My Business (GMB) profile is one of the most effective ways to enhance your visibility and attract local customers. This activity, combined with strategic local citation management, will significantly boost your business's online footprint and drive success.

Why Google My Business Matters

Why Google My Business Matters

Google My Business is a free tool that allows businesses to manage their online presence across Google, including Search and Maps. A well-optimized GMB profile can help your business stand out in local search results, making it easier for potential customers to find you. Here are some key benefits of having an optimized GMB profile:




  • Increased Visibility: An optimized GMB profile can improve your business's visibility in local search results, ensuring that you appear prominently when potential customers search for services or products like yours in their area.

  • Enhanced Credibility: A complete and accurate GMB profile enhances your business's credibility. By providing essential information such as your business hours, location, and contact details, you build trust with potential customers.

  • Improved Customer Engagement: GMB allows you to interact directly with customers through reviews, Q&A, and posts. Engaging with your audience helps build relationships and encourages repeat business.

  • Insights and Analytics: GMB provides valuable insights into how customers find and interact with your business online. This data can inform your marketing strategies and help you make informed decisions.

Steps to Optimize Your Google My Business Profile




  • Complete Your Profile: Ensure all sections of your GMB profile are filled out accurately, including your business name, address, phone number, website, and hours of operation.

  • Choose the Right Categories: Select relevant categories that best describe your business. Choosing the right categories helps Google understand your business and match it with relevant search queries.

  • Add High-Quality Photos: Upload professional photos of your business, products, and services. Visual content can significantly impact a customer's decision to choose your business over competitors.

  • Encourage and Respond to Reviews: Encourage satisfied customers to leave positive reviews and respond promptly to all reviews. Engaging with reviews shows that you value customer feedback and are committed to providing excellent service.

  • Utilize Posts and Updates: Regularly update your GMB profile with posts about promotions, events, or news. This consistent activity keeps your audience informed and engaged with your business.

The Importance of Local Citation Management

Local citation management involves ensuring that your business's name, address, and phone number (NAP) are consistently listed across various online directories and platforms. Here's why it's critical to your business's success:





  • Boosts Local SEO: Consistent and accurate citations help improve your local search engine rankings. Search engines like Google use this information to validate your business's existence and relevance in local search results.

  • Builds Trust and Authority: Consistent citations across reputable platforms establish your business as a credible and authoritative entity in your industry.

  • Drives Traffic and Leads: Accurate citations make it easier for potential customers to find your business online, driving more traffic to your website and physical location.

  • Enhances Brand Visibility: Being listed on multiple platforms increases your brand's visibility and exposure to a broader audience.


Optimizing your Google My Business profile and managing local citations are essential strategies for enhancing your business's online presence and attracting local customers. By taking the time to complete and maintain your GMB profile, engage with your audience, and ensure consistent citations, you set your business up for success in the digital landscape. Embrace these practices to stay ahead of the competition and drive growth in your local market.

Discover Why Independence Village of Petoskey Earned the 2026 Best of Senior Living Award

Update Celebrating Excellence in Senior CareIndependence Village of Petoskey has added another feather to its cap. The senior living community has been honored with the prestigious A Place for Mom 2026 Best of Senior Living Award, highlighting its commitment to providing exceptional care to its residents. This award is not only a mark of excellence but also reflects the community's consistent dedication to improving the quality of life for seniors and their families.What Makes This Award Stand Out?The Best of Senior Living Award is awarded to communities that achieve an average review score of 9.5 or higher and accumulate a minimum of 10 reviews within the specified award period. In 2025, only the top 1-2% of senior living providers across the U.S. and Canada managed to qualify and win this accolade. This achievement underscores the importance of fostering not just excellent physical care, but also an enriching and supportive living environment.Understanding Consumer Confidence Through ReviewsThe evaluation process hinges on real feedback from residents and their families. Margaret Cabell, Chief Community Relations Officer at A Place for Mom, emphasizes that their platform has collected nearly half a million reviews. “These first-hand experiences provide invaluable insights on quality of care, staff satisfaction, and more,” she declared. This context makes awards like these critical, as they guide families in making informed decisions about senior care.The Larger Impact: StoryPoint Group's LegacyIndependence Village is part of the StoryPoint Group, which had 75 communities recognized this year—a record number. Why Brands Must Expand Digital Marketing to Boost Trustpilot and G2 Visibility

Update Understanding the Importance of Brand Visibility In today's fast-paced digital landscape, how well brands manage their online presence is a pivotal factor in achieving business success. With emerging platforms like Trustpilot and G2, enhancing visibility and managing reputation has never been more accessible yet challenging. These platforms serve as critical touchpoints for customer feedback, influencing purchasing decisions and shaping brand trust. By improving their visibility on these review platforms, businesses can foster trust among potential customers, leading to increased engagement and sales. How Reputation Marketing Can Elevate Your Brand Reputation marketing moves beyond mere brand visibility; its core mission is to build trust through authentic customer experiences. As noted, traditional advertising methods can often backfire, leading consumers to disengage from brands they view as overbearing or disingenuous. Statistics indicate that a staggering 52% of consumers report negative feelings toward brands due to overexposure to ads. Instead, businesses can embrace reputation marketing strategies that leverage user-generated content and reviews, creating authentic narratives that resonate deeply with potential customers. Engagement Strategies: The Power of Storytelling At the heart of successful reputation marketing is effective storytelling. Brands can significantly enhance their visibility by sharing compelling stories that connect emotionally with their audiences. Utilizing platforms where customers can share their experiences enables businesses to cultivate a narrative that reflects their brand values. This strategy mirrors insights from industry leaders who emphasize that storytelling makes brands memorable—messages presented as stories can be 22 times more memorable than traditional facts. Engaging storytelling fosters genuine connections, driving brand loyalty and trust. The Role of SEO and Avoiding Keyword Cannibalization SEO plays a vital role in driving organic traffic to brand pages, particularly on platforms like G2. Optimizing content for search engines involves careful keyword management to avoid cannibalization, which can dilute a brand's online presence. By focusing on user intent and leveraging relevant keywords naturally, brands can improve their search rankings. However, businesses must tread carefully; overstuffing content with keywords can lead to penalties and reduced credibility. It's crucial to craft quality content that aligns positively with user experiences and expectations. Leveraging Digital Marketing for Authentic Engagement As digital marketing evolves, companies are increasingly moving toward engagement strategies that prioritize authenticity over aggressive tactics. Tactics such as guerilla marketing can effectively capture attention without disrupting potential customers. Companies such as Red Bull provide powerful examples of how impactful campaigns rooted in real experiences can create lasting visibility. Such strategies leverage the power of creativity and innovation, allowing brands to stand out in crowded marketplaces by promoting authenticity. Practical Tips for Improving G2 Visibility To further enhance visibility on G2, companies should ensure that their profiles are not merely promotional but provide value through informative, detailed descriptions of their products and services. Maintaining an active presence by engaging with user-generated content and utilizing G2 badges can also dramatically enhance brand credibility. Research shows that 92% of consumers are more likely to trust brands that have displayed trust logos on their sites. By regularly optimizing listings, businesses can promote ongoing customer engagement and foster a sense of community. Why Reputation Marketing is Vital for Today's Business Leaders

Update Reputation: The Unseen Threat to Marketing Leaders In a rapidly evolving business landscape, reputational management has emerged as a crucial battleground for marketing leaders, especially CMOs, founders, and CEOs. With mounting economic pressures—including tighter budgets and increasing demands for accountability—brand reputation is transitioning from a supplemental aspect of marketing to a core business asset. In 2026, visibility isn't merely about ego; it's an integral structure that supports strategic positioning. Why Reputation Matters More Than Ever The importance of reputation cannot be overstated. Current data indicates only a third of CMOs expect budget growth, making it imperative for leaders to leverage their reputations to enhance brand visibility and appeal. The trend towards in-house agency operations—over 80% of major advertisers are utilizing internal teams—further aggravates the situation, leading to less cohesive public narratives. As the industry becomes increasingly fragmented, traditional external agencies face consolidation, shrinking their role in crafting the brand narrative. Marketing leaders must recognize that silence in the public arena can be interpreted as absence or incompetence, potentially undermining trust and authority. The Role of Live Events in Reputation Building Prestigious events, such as the Cannes Lions International Festival of Creativity, serve as crucial touchpoints for reputation formation in the marketing sphere. Gathering over 12,000 senior leaders, these events are vital not only for networking but for establishing a collective industry vision. The expansion of the festival into areas like culture and technology reflects the interconnectedness of brand influence across mediums, requiring leaders to articulate their viewpoints effectively. In 2026, these gatherings are not just about showcasing creativity but play a pivotal role in shaping the reputational landscape. Leaders now need to be adept at navigating public discourse around intersections of sports, entertainment, and technology. Preparing for a Reputation-Driven Future Unfortunately, many leaders are ill-equipped to manage their reputations proactively. Most have been trained in operational roles, lacking the skills to communicate their authority and vision effectively. This creates a disconnect where leaders miss opportunities to build what McKinsey describes as "durable reputation equity." Instead of relying on outdated PR tactics, leaders should take a strategic approach to their public presence, ensuring their narratives align with marketplace realities. The Social Dynamics of Reputation Management Edelman’s Trust Barometer reveals a significant disconnect; people tend to trust individuals more than corporate messaging. Yet, many executives continue to dissociate their personal brand from their corporate identity, leading to losses in trust and visibility. In the digital age, silence does not infer humility—it signals a lack of engagement. This is a critical moment for leaders to understand that cultivating their public image is not superficial; it reflects their commitment to transparency and relevance.
